Africa is home to some of the brightest minds who have not only excelled in their respective fields but have also made ...
Israeli military strikes killed at least 40 Palestinians overnight and yesterday in the Gaza Strip, medics said, as efforts to revive Gaza ceasefire talks received a boost with officials from the ...